Rare Ophiura Brittle Starfish Large Fossil Plate jewellery A large flat palmstone ofOphiura ophiura "Serpent Star" Brittle Starfish. These Ophiura brittle stars are Ordovician in age, or approximately 450 million years. The dark orange coloration is due to the oxidization of iron pyrite. May includes other small fossil species or starfish limbs. This fossil has an incredibly clear image of the shape of the fallen starfish. Situated in limestone.
